Seton Hall University is a private Catholic university located in South Orange, New Jersey, United States. Founded in 1856, it is one of the oldest diocesan universities in the U.S. and is known for its strong academic tradition, professional education, and commitment to ethical leadership.
For international students, Seton Hall University offers a welcoming and diverse campus environment with dedicated international student services, academic advising, and cultural integration support. The university provides a wide range of undergraduate and graduate programs in business, law, diplomacy and international relations, nursing, health sciences, education, and liberal arts.
Seton Hall is particularly well known for its School of Law, Stillman School of Business, and School of Diplomacy and International Relations, which emphasize experiential learning, internships, and global engagement. Students gain practical experience through clinical programs, research opportunities, and partnerships with organizations in the New York metropolitan area.
Located just outside New York City, Seton Hall University offers international students access to one of the world’s leading hubs for finance, law, media, healthcare, and international organizations.
